Lo obtengo después de actualizar en Synaptic Manager
Recientemente hice una instalación limpia de Ubuntu 17.04 desde 16.10.
mensaje de error:-
W: Download is performed unsandboxed as root as file '/var/cache/apt/archives/partial/samba-libs_2%3a4.5.8+dfsg-0ubuntu0.17.04.1_i386.deb' couldn't be accessed by user '_apt'. - pkgAcquire::Run (13: Permission denied)
Respuestas:
Por lo general, apt utiliza al usuario
_apt
para descargar paquetes. En su caso_apt
, no tiene permiso de escritura para ninguno de/var/cache/apt/archives/partial/
los archivos existentes,/var/cache/apt/archives/partial/samba-libs_2%3a4.5.8+dfsg-0ubuntu0.17.04.1_i386.deb
por lo que descargó el archivo comoroot
.Asegúrese de que
/var/cache/apt/archives/partial/
todo lo que se encuentra debajo se pueda escribir_apt
, por ejemplo, ejecutandofuente
vagrant
que no se puede cambiar. ¿Cómo puedo resolver esto allí? tal vez solo desactive la advertencia, porque en mi VM de prueba no es un problema si apt se ejecuta desde la raízsynced_folder_opts
chowning
ychmoding
:sudo chmod -Rv 755 /root/.synaptic/tmp
. ¡Después, no más errores!También tuve este problema en un Debian Stretch (nueva instalación de una máquina virtual Xen), resultó que era un problema con sudo.
No se pudo hacer ningún sudo en la máquina.
Más precisamente, el
/
directorio raíz del sistema estaba en 700 (drwx ------). A lochmod 755 /
arregló.fuente